I applied online via Indeed. After 2 days, I received an email asking for an interview. This was for the Pacific Northwest position. I chose a date and then the interview was conducted. There was just 1 round for it.
Interview questions [1]
Question 1
Was offered an interview and had to prepare a short lesson on a topic I would be teaching as an instructor. I chose to make a PPT about Python 101. The interviewer gave details about the position, expected work hour and salary. Some behavorial questions were asked after the PPT: 1. If two students stray out of the group and don't participate in any group activities what would you do ? 2. If there is an uncharacteristically sad student in the class, what do you think might be the reasons for the behavior ?
